Café Kuya in Brossard is a fantastic spot to experience Filipino-inspired flavors in a cozy & welcoming setting. The ube iced latte was the highlight of my visit-it has a beautiful purple color, a smooth & creamy texture, & just the right amount of sweetness.
The earthy, subtly nutty flavor of ube pairs surprisingly well with the espresso, creating a unique & refreshing drink.
I also love how the café showcases Filipino flavors in a modern way, making it a great place to discover or revisit a taste that's deeply rooted in Filipino cuisine. The friendly service & relaxing atmosphere make the experience even better. If you're in Brossard, the ube iced latte is definitely worth trying!

We love this cafe, really good coffee, breakfast sandwiches & great & friendly service :). Also good cold drinks (ube syrup, matcha etc). They often have specials (kamayan, wraps, burgers etc) & partner with locals (pop up yoga event, pastry features, floristry etc) so would recommend following them on IG!
